Looking back at April: Over $2B in funding finds its way to Israeli startups
A new Unicorn, five acquisitions, and one exceptional day of VC funding. This what Israeli startups did in April Oshry Alkeslasi / 3 May 2021 • 4 min read
Following a record-setting month, where 6 Israeli companies joined the Israeli Unicorn club and $2.7 billion in funding found its way to Israeli startups - April continued the trend in full force. Last month 40 different startups raised a combined $2.29 billion.
Is the peak behind us?
You really can’t start dissecting April 2021 performance without noting April 7th - the day where 4 Israeli companies, alone, brought in over $1 billion in funding. The rise of the machine: Alexa invests in Israeli AI enabler
Founded by former Google and Wix directors, Comet deploys an MLOps platform for managing AI/ML experiments and models. Among the company s investors: Amazon Alexa Fund Yaneev Avital / 13 Apr 2021 • 2 min read
One of the biggest challenges facing the AI community today is developing accurate enough models that can provide real value for a product or business. Comet, an Israeli startup providing MLOps solutions, secured $13 million in Series A funding from a number of investors, including Amazon Alexa Fund.
